Description

A rare opportunity to own a beautifully designed two-bedroom first floor apartment in the heart of Brondesbury Park. Set within a boutique new development of just six apartments, this 789 sq ft home combines elegant interiors, a private terrace, and outstanding connectivity.

Every element at Aylestone Place has been carefully considered — from the materials underfoot to the refined atmosphere throughout. This is craftsmanship without compromise, where smart technology meets timeless design, blending practicality with presence.

The open-plan living and dining space opens directly onto the private terrace, creating a seamless indoor-outdoor flow. A bespoke Italian-made kitchen features Arabesco Cremo stone worktops, Siemens and Bosch appliances, a Franke Maris 3-in-1 hot water tap, and ISE waste disposal unit.

There are two double bedrooms, both with built-in wardrobes, including a principal suite with a sleek en-suite shower room. A contemporary family bathroom, underfloor heating, European oak herringbone flooring, and premium finishes throughout complete this considered and stylish home.

Situation

Located in the heart of Brondesbury Park, this address offers outstanding connectivity and a vibrant local community. Just 0.6 miles from Willesden Green Underground Station (Jubilee Line) and 0.7 miles from Brondesbury Park Overground Station, residents benefit from fast and direct links into central London, including Euston, Baker Street, and Bond Street. The nearby A5 and North Circular also provide excellent road connections across the capital.

The surrounding area is rich in character, with a variety of independent cafés, restaurants, and shops along Salusbury Road and in nearby Willesden Green. For green open spaces, both Queen’s Park and Gladstone Park are within easy reach, offering a welcome retreat from city life.

Educational options in the wider area include well-regarded state and independent schools, with access to institutions in nearby Hampstead and St John’s Wood. With its blend of urban convenience and neighbourhood charm, Brondesbury Park continues to be one of North West London’s most desirable locations.
